1. Introduction to URL Shortening
URL shortening is a technique on the web during which a long URL can be transformed into a shorter, extra workable form. This shortened URL redirects to the initial lengthy URL when frequented. Products and services like Bitly and TinyURL are very well-acknowledged examples of URL shorteners. The necessity for URL shortening arose with the appearance of social websites platforms like Twitter, where character limitations for posts made it hard to share lengthy URLs.

Beyond social networking, URL shorteners are handy in advertising strategies, e-mail, and printed media in which prolonged URLs is often cumbersome.

two. Main Parts of the URL Shortener
A URL shortener typically includes the next elements:

Internet Interface: This can be the entrance-stop section where by users can enter their long URLs and receive shortened versions. It can be a simple kind on the Website.
Database: A database is essential to shop the mapping among the original lengthy URL along with the shortened Variation. Datab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, or NoSQL solutions like MongoDB can be employed.
Redirection Logic: This is the backend logic that requires the brief URL and redirects the user towards the corresponding lengthy URL. This logic is generally implemented in the web server or an software layer.
API: Lots of URL shorteners deliver an API to ensure third-party apps can programmatically shorten URLs and retrieve the first prolonged URLs.
3. Developing the URL Shortening Algorithm
The crux of a URL shortener lies in its algorithm for changing a protracted URL into a short 1. Several methods is usually utilized, for example:

Hashing: The prolonged URL may be hashed into a fixed-sizing string, which serves because the short URL. On the other hand, hash collisions (unique URLs resulting in the same hash) must be managed.
Base62 Encoding: One common solution is to make use of Base62 encoding (which makes use of 62 figures: 0-nine, A-Z, along with a-z) on an integer ID. The ID corresponds on the entry in the database. This technique makes sure that the short URL is as quick as you can.
Random String Technology: Yet another technique should be to make a random string of a hard and fast length (e.g., six people) and check if it’s already in use while in the databases. If not, it’s assigned to your lengthy URL.
4. Databases Administration
The database schema for the URL shortener is frequently uncomplicated, with two Principal fields:

ID: A novel identifier for each URL entry.
Long URL: The initial URL that should be shortened.
Brief URL/Slug: The limited Variation from the URL, generally saved as a unique string.
Along with these, you should store metadata such as the development day, expiration day, and the number of instances the limited URL has long been accessed.

5. Handling Redirection
Redirection is actually a important Element of the URL shortener's operation. Whenever a consumer clicks on a brief URL, the company needs to rapidly retrieve the original URL from your database and redirect the consumer using an HTTP 301 (lasting redirect) or 302 (short-term redirect) position code.

Efficiency is essential listed here, as the process must be almost instantaneous. Approaches like database indexing and caching (e.g., employing Redis or Memcached) can be utilized to hurry up the retrieval process.

6. Protection Considerations
Safety is an important problem in URL shorteners:

Malicious URLs: A URL shortener is often abused to spread malicious inbound links. Utilizing URL validation, blacklisting, or integrating with third-celebration protection products and services to check URLs just before shortening them can mitigate this chance.
Spam Avoidance: Level limiting and CAPTCHA can stop abuse by spammers looking to crank out Many brief URLs.
7. Scalability
Because the URL shortener grows, it may have to manage a lot of URLs and redirect requests. This demands a scalable architecture, quite possibly involving load balancers, dispersed databases, and microservices.

Load Balancing: Distribute targeted visitors throughout various servers to take care of superior hundreds.
Dispersed Databases: Use databases which will scale horizontally, like Cassandra or MongoDB.
Microservices: Individual worries like URL shortening, analytics, and redirection into diverse companies to enhance scalability and maintainability.
8. Analytics
URL shorteners often provide analytics to trace how often a short URL is clicked, where by the targeted visitors is coming from, together with other valuable metrics. This needs logging Each and every redirect and possibly integrating with analytics platforms.
